Step 7 — Encoding detection rollout. The Quillhaven upload service now runs the Ferndale charset sniffer before any text file is parsed. Future maintainers: the sniffer is deployed as a sidecar, and its detection tables must match the version pinned in the release manifest, or mixed-encoding files will silently fall back to Latin-1. Verify the table checksum, then confirm the sidecar health endpoint reports the new build. Finally, sign the rollout manifest so downstream nodes accept it, using the key shown below.

rollout seal: bky4_x7Gc

### Step 4 — Enable log sampling on Chattervane

Chattervane emits roughly 40k lines per minute at peak, so set sampling to 1:50 on info-level logs before rollout; errors stay unsampled. Confirm the sampler config lands in the canary first. The sampled-logs shipper verifies its config bundle against the deploy key below.

signing key of bagap-yawep = bky13_TbfT6ZMUoGJo2

**CI note: timezone weirdness in report exports**

Heads up, support folks — if a customer says their Ledgerpine export shows times shifted by a few hours, it's probably the CI image. The export workers got rebuilt last week and the base image defaults to UTC, while older workers used the account's locale. Fix is rolling out; meanwhile tell customers the data itself is fine, just the display offset. Affected exports carry the build token shown below.

build token for bajof-tahop: htk4_a981

The Quillrender team measured template rendering latency across the Fennelwick cluster this week and found that partial caching cuts p95 render time by roughly 40% under sustained load. The /render/v2 endpoint now accepts a cache-hint header, which reviewers should exercise during benchmarks. Authentication remains mandatory for all benchmark calls; requests must include the bearer token shown below:

portal login ticket: eyJhbGciOiJIUzI1NiIsInR5cCI6IkpXVCJ9.eyJzdWIiOiIwEOsktwVNwIn0.-UJU3fdyyCgG